In July and August there is an open air cinema in front of the Schloss Gottesaue - a spectacular place to enjoy open air movies. Especially, if the screen is 24 x 10 meters big!
They usually show very recent movies, but also all time classics like "Casablanca" or "Ben Hur"!
The movies start at 10 p.m. in July and at 9.30 p.m. in August.

The Schauburg also has a summer time open air theatre where they show only (best of my knowledge) german language movies. We first went here looking for the indoor theatre.
But hey. A beer garden with a movie. Now we're talking. Beer typically starts at 8pm (20hrs) with the film starting about 2 hours later.
